Data Acquisition & Operations Specialist

About Cobalt Intelligence

Cobalt Intelligence provides API access to Secretary of State business registration data across the United States. Our customers rely on us for accurate, up-to-date corporate filing information delivered through a usage-based pricing model. We serve enterprise clients and growing businesses alike, and we take pride in being a lean, high-impact team.

Role Overview

We are looking for a resourceful, detail-oriented person to own the process of acquiring business registration data from Secretary of State offices across all 50 states (and territories). This is a relationship-driven, persistence-heavy role—you’ll be the person who figures out how to get the data, whether that means making phone calls, sending emails, filing public records requests, or navigating government portals. You don’t need to be a developer, but you do need to be highly comfortable using AI tools to work smarter and faster.

As a secondary responsibility, you’ll help with day-to-day business operations including invoicing, subscription management, and other administrative tasks that keep the business running smoothly.

Primary Responsibilities

Data Acquisition (approx. 70%)

  • Research and establish contact with Secretary of State offices and equivalent agencies in all 50 states and U.S. territories

  • Initiate and manage ongoing relationships with government contacts to obtain business registration data on a regular cadence

  • Use whatever communication method is most effective—phone calls, emails, FOIA/public records requests, online portals—to secure data access

  • Track acquisition status, costs, timelines, and renewal dates for each state in an organized system

  • Troubleshoot issues with data delivery, formatting, or access and escalate technical problems as needed

  • Stay current on changes to state filing systems, fees, and data availability

  • Leverage AI tools (ChatGPT, Claude, etc.) to draft correspondence, research contacts, summarize regulations, and streamline repetitive tasks

Operations Support (approx. 30%)

  • Manage customer invoicing and follow up on outstanding payments

  • Set up and maintain customer subscriptions and billing configurations

  • Assist with general administrative tasks such as documentation, data entry, and process improvement

  • Help respond to routine customer inquiries and route technical issues appropriately

  • Support contract and pricing administration as needed
